Transaction 17fa23dbfc49f04931f3b57cd1a0e1f850bba5f59194d81984118fb8e04d6e92

1 Input
2 Outputs
  • 17fa23dbfc49f04931f3b57cd1a0e1f850bba5f59194d81984118fb8e04d6e92:0
  • value  30668290
    address  1HsDpQocr3KyojpmgMajb64wib8QeHYg4x
  • 17fa23dbfc49f04931f3b57cd1a0e1f850bba5f59194d81984118fb8e04d6e92:1
  • value  442586673
    address  18rznGm4nHmkbyDYSrNL9KLUNf7Q4UYCeC